python二級試卷中超級基礎但是超級易錯的題目

2021-10-03 07:58:23 字數 825 閱讀 1972

11

.執行以下程式,輸入」93python22」,輸出結果是:

w =input

('請輸入數字和字母構成的字串:'

)for x in w:

if'0'

<= x <=

'9':

continue

else

: w.replace(x,'')

print

(w)a python9322

b python

c 93python22

d 9322

正確答案: c

這題的關鍵點在於replace替換字串之後需要用w來接收,不能用別的字母來接收,

因為他還在迴圈內,還需要接著替換別的。所以這個沒有接收的就相當於什麼操作都

沒有進行,自然輸入的是什麼輸出的也就是什麼啦。

14

.以下程式的輸出結果是:

s =0

deffun

(num)

:try

: s += num

return s

except

:return

0return

5print

(fun(2)

)a 0

b 2c unboundlocalerror

d 5正確答案: a

本題考查的是在函式內部使用乙個外部定義的變數需要使用global宣告,否則無法使用,

本題就是因為try裡面報錯找不到s,所以才會執行except裡的**塊。

Python計算機二級考試程式題(試卷一)

請在 處使用一行 或表示式替換 注意 請不要修改其他已給出 s input 請輸入乙個字串 print format s 請在 處使用一行 或表示式替換 注意 請不要修改其他已給出 a,b 0,1while a 50 print a,end a,b b,a b 請在 處使用一行 或表示式替換 注意 ...

Python計算機二級考試程式題(試卷五)

請在 處使用一行 替換 注意 請不要修改其他已給出 s eval input 請輸入乙個數字 ls 0 for i in range 65 91 chr i print 輸出大寫字母 format ls s 請在 處使用一行 或表示式替換 注意 請不要修改其他已給出 s input 請輸入乙個十進位...

二級公共基礎(一)

1 演算法的基本概念 1.1演算法 解決方 而完整的描述。演算法不等於程式,也不等於計算方法。1.2基本特性 可行性 確定性 有窮性 擁有足夠的情報 1.3演算法設計的基本方法 例舉法 歸納法 遞推 遞迴 減半遞推法 回溯法 1.4演算法複雜度 演算法複雜度包括時間複雜度和空間複雜度。時間複雜度 執...